[QUOTE="CaliforniaCheez, post: 24540, member: 167"] It is frustrating to lose a game by 2 points and then one by one point. Looking over the stats at NFL.com for yardage, the Packers rank the following in the NFL. Offense Scoring 26th Rushing 25th Passing 14th Defense Scoring 15th Rushing 16th Passing 14th Special Teams Kickoff Coverage 9th Punt Coverage 5th Kickoff Returns 26th Punt Returns 14th Turnover ratio 32nd worst in the league For decades every press conference the coach has cliche's: turnovers are killers, you have to run the ball, and stop the run. Now if in July or August you had said the defense would be middle of the league you would have accepted average as an improvement. Being in the bottom quarter of the league in rushing will cost you a few games. Your season is going to be terrible if you average 3 turnovers a game and get a turnover every other game. Statistics speak volumes. [/QUOTE]
